Abstract

Detectors for new energy frontier experiments require excellent spatial, time, and energy resolutions to resolve the structure of collimated high-energy jets. In a future Muon Collider, the beam-induced backgrounds represent the main challenge for detector design and event reconstruction. Our proposal - Crilin - consists in a semi-homogeneous Cherenkov electromagnetic calorimeter based on P b F 2 crystals with surface-mount UV-extended Silicon Photomultipliers readout.
